Everything You Should Know Before Moving to Baggs, WY

Considering a move to Baggs, WY? This friendly town of 418 offers affordable living, with median home prices at $140,000 and average rents around $700. Enjoy a safe, peaceful atmosphere, low crime rates, and a short average commute of just 15 minutes. Baggs boasts a high rate of homeownership, a close-knit community, and abundant sunny days—perfect for those seeking a quieter lifestyle with access to local schools and beautiful Wyoming landscapes.

What is the weather like in Baggs, WY year-round?

The town experiences all four seasons, featuring cold winters with lows around 5°F and warm summers reaching up to 85°F. With about 64% sunny days and under 11 inches of annual rainfall, Baggs offers a dry and sunny climate typical of southern Wyoming.

How are the schools in Baggs, WY?

Baggs is home to Little Snake River Valley School, offering small class sizes and a personalized learning environment for local students. Those seeking higher education can access Western Wyoming Community College within reasonable driving distance.
